## Cron-to-Workflow Migration — Approvals

All cron jobs moving to the Wrenfield workflow engine need approval before cutover. Requirements: idempotency confirmed, retry policy defined, old cron disabled same day. Batch migrations capped at five jobs per week. No exceptions during freeze windows. Track status on the migration board. Final approval authority rests with the owner below.

named custodian: Brivan Eliath Quenox Frador

## Support

Graphloom is maintained by the Corveil tooling group on a best-effort basis. Before filing an issue, check the troubleshooting page and confirm you're on a supported renderer version. Include your graph export and version string in any report. For maintainer questions or handover matters, write to the address below.

alerts address for bajop-yahog: istwyn@lumiclabs.internal

**Mgmt Meeting Minutes — Retiring the Brightline Range**

Quick recap for sales leads at Fenholt Supplies: we agreed to retire the Brightline fixture range by year-end. Remaining stock moves to clearance pricing next month, and accounts on standing orders get migrated to the Lumetta range. Trade-in incentives were approved in principle. The confidential note on next steps sits just below.

board note of bajof-bajeg: The pricing group signed off on a budget of $13.4 million for Project Sildor. The renewal with Lamixek Holdings closes at $48.9 million a year, 49 percent above the last contract.

To: Executive Team — Re: Second-source search. Board members, brief update. Our sole supplier of the Kestrel valve assembly, Marnoway Precision, flagged capacity limits for next year. We have screened four alternates; two passed initial quality audits — Olbrecht Castings and Tarne Fabrication. Sample runs begin this month, qualification expected within ninety days. Dual-sourcing adds roughly 4% to unit cost, offset by reduced expedite fees. Strategic context is captured in the confidential note below.

confidential, kagup-bafog: Fraaxax Group is in early talks to buy Soroxox Group for about $343.8 million. The Olidor launch date is June 14, and nothing goes to the press before then. Legal wants the Aldmirek Logistics term sheet signed before July 23.